D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
 
The successful applicant must provide professional accounting services in compliance with the Code of Ethics for Professional Accountants (including Independence Standards), including the following services and related outputs within the agreed time frames.
 
To witness:
Bookkeeping - Statutory BIR Compliance's Filing
Other Government Agencies Filing (SSS/HDMF/PHIC)
Annual Audited Financial Statements for the year 2023 and onwards
Services include but are not limited to the following:
Prepare monthly and quarterly value-added tax (VAT) returns 2550M/2550Q and the related VAT Relief on or before the specified due date
Prepare monthly remittance returns of income taxes withheld on compensation 1601C on or before the specified due date;
Prepare monthly, and quarterly remittance returns of creditable withholding taxes expanded 0619E/1601EQ;
Prepare quarterly income tax returns 1702Q on or before the specified due date;
Prepare a Quarterly Summary List of Sales and Purchases (SLSP) on or before the specified due date
Prepare annual information return on income taxes withheld on compensation, including an alphabetical list of employees 1604CF on or before the specified due date;
Annual information return on creditable withholding taxes expanded 1604E, including an alphabetical list of payees
Prepare Quarterly SAWT/QWAP/MAP on or before the specified due date
Review of 2307s (Certificate of Creditable Tax Withheld at Source) from all suppliers;
Assist with the preparation and updating of Books of Accounts for BIR
Conduct tax planning and compliance reviews to ensure that the company avoids high taxes and tax exposures legally.
Any consultation on tax and accounting will be part of the scope of work.
Other Government Agencies Filing (SSS/HDMF/PHIC)
Monthly SSS contribution/loans remittance
Monthly HDMF contribution/loans remittance
Monthly PHIC contribution remittance
Audited Financial Statements and Income Tax Return (Inclusive of GIS Filing)
 
Audit of the Statement of Financial Position of the Company for the year ended December 31, 2022, the related Statement of Comprehensive Income, Statement of Changes in Fund Balances, and Statement of Cash Flows for the fiscal years then ended, for the purpose of expressing an External Audit Opinion on them.
 
The engagement will cover the following output:
2023 Audited Financial Statements
Income Tax Return (ITR) filing and submission to the Bureau of Internal Revenue (BIR)
GIS Filing
